数据结构与算法之美 - 学习笔记 为什么插入排序比冒泡排序更受欢迎 Q:插入排序和冒泡排序的时间复杂度相同,都是 O(n²),在实际的软件开发中...
数据结构与算法之美 - 学习笔记 递归 什么是递归 1.递归是一种非常高效、简洁的编码技巧,一种应用非常广泛的算法,比如 DFS 深度优先搜索...
栈题目练习 标题末尾序号对应Leedcode题序,解题思路在上篇已提到,这里为具体代码实现,使用JavaScript 1. 有效的括号 20 2...
数据结构与算法之美 - 学习笔记 引出问题:浏览器如何实现前进后退功能[图片上传失败...(image-56f9b3-1632473114756...
链表题目练习 序号对应Leedcode题序,解题思路在上篇已提到,这里为具体代码实现,使用JavaScript 1. 单链表反转 206 2. ...
数据结构与算法之美 - 学习笔记 链表(Linked list) 链表是一种物理存储单元上非连续、非顺序的存储结构,数据元素的逻辑顺序是通过链表...
数据结构与算法之美 - 学习笔记 时间复杂度 算法中的语句执行次数称为语句频度或时间频度,记为 T(n)。算法的时间复杂度也就是算法的时间度量,...
官方解释 分发 action。options 里可以有 root: true,它允许在命名空间模块里分发根的 action。返回一个解析所有被触...
最近在进行算法的相关学习,这里推荐大家可以在力扣上进行学习。这个网站提供诸多技术题库,含算法、数据结构、系统设计等,并且解析详细。支持各种编程语...